Ethylene Inhibits Root Elongation during Alkaline Stress through AUXIN1 and Associated Changes in Auxin Accumulation.
Plant physiology - 1 Aug 2015
Li Juan, Xu Heng-Hao, Liu Wen-Cheng, Zhang Xiao-Wei, Lu Ying-Tang
Abstract excerpt
Soil alkalinity causes major reductions in yield and quality of crops worldwide. The plant root is the first organ sensing soil alkalinity, which results in shorter primary roots. However, the mechanism underlying alkaline stress-mediated inhibition of root elongation remains to be further elucidated. Here, we report that alkaline conditions inhibit primary root elongation of Arabidopsis (Arabidopsis thaliana)...
